Schedule: Full time Adult Congenital Heart Disease call approximately 1 in 5 nights as secons call Salaried (Exempt) Department/Division Highlights: The Adult Congenital Heart Disease (ACHD) Program at Children's Wisconsin provides comprehensive, longitudinal care for a diverse population of patients, including those with complex and high-risk congenital heart disease. Clinical services encompass inpatient consultative care in the Cardiac Intensive Care Unit (CICU) and Acute Cardiac Unit, as well as specialized ACHD outpatient clinics held multiple times each week. Care is delivered primarily at Children's Wisconsin and Froedtert Hospital, allowing for seamless integration of pediatric and adult congenital services across the care continuum. The successful candidate will join a well-established, multidisciplinary ACHD team that includes five experienced adult congenital cardiologists, two nurse practitioners, three dedicated nurse coordinators, and three congenital heart surgeons. This collaborative environment supports high-quality clinical care, programmatic growth, and ongoing quality improvement initiatives. In addition to ACHD responsibilities, the candidate will be integrated into the Pediatric Cardiology Division within the Herma Heart Institute (HHI). Pediatric clinical roles and responsibilities will be tailored to the candidate's interests, training background, and institutional needs. The HHI represents one of the largest and most comprehensive congenital heart programs in the region, comprising three congenital heart surgeons, 30 pediatric and adult congenital cardiologists, eight pediatric cardiac anesthesiologists, 11 pediatric intensivists, 22 advanced practice providers, and a total workforce exceeding 300 members. The HHI also has a strong academic and research mission, with eight research-intensive principal investigators leading multiple active NIH-funded and equivalent projects, as well as a robust quality and outcomes program. Research activities are supported through the Children's Research Institute of Children's Wisconsin. In 2025, the HHI received more than $58 million in endowed funds through partnership with the Children's Wisconsin Foundation to support research, education, and clinical innovation, with a strategic emphasis on precision medicine and tissue engineering related to congenital heart disease. Through the Forward Pediatric Alliance (FPA)-a collaborative partnership between the Herma Heart Institute at Children's Wisconsin and UW Health Kids/American Family Children's Hospital-the program benefits from a strong regional network and meaningful opportunities for cross-institutional clinical, educational, and research collaboration.
